The short version
Population has grown 48% since 2019. 16%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 33%. Median home value is $112,500. With a median age of 47.1, the population is older than the US median of 38.8. Poverty is rare here, at 3.3% of residents.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Sunshine, New Mexico?
Sunshine, New Mexico has about 487 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
Is Sunshine, New Mexico expensive?
In Sunshine, New Mexico, the median home is worth about $112,500.
How educated are people in Sunshine, New Mexico?
About 16.3% of adults age 25 and over in Sunshine, New Mexico h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Sunshine, New Mexico?
About 3.3% of people in Sunshine, New Mexico live below the federal poverty line.
